Jobless increase

Unemployment rose by 1,248 to 7,266 in the 12-month period to last May.

The National Statistics Office said the number of men registering for work rose by 943 and that for women by 305.

Most of the unemployed, 40.6 per cent, were 45 years old and over. Those aged 20 and over increased by 13.3 per cent.

Men mostly sought elementary duties and trades while women preferred clerical or service-oriented jobs.
